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a simply-structure good-appearance backrest structure for a chair capable of preventing damage in another object or in a back lever itself even if the back lever collides against the object when the chair is turned. SOLUTION: In the chair, a back plate 5 is supported by means of a pair of left and right metallic back levers 6 extended backward from beneath a seat 8 to the upper side, and the back face and the outside face of each back lever 6 are covered with a cover 22 made of a soft material.
